Committee Minutes (ID # 25-1611) Agenda Ready: Approval of the Minutes of the Legislative Matters Committee Meeting of October 20, 2025. Ordinances 2. Order (ID # 25-1439) Referred for Recommendation: By Councilor Wilson, Councilor Mbah, Councilor Clingan, Councilor Strezo and Councilor Scott That the City Clerk work with this Council to amend the Code of Ordinances to better regulate the sale of second-hand goods. 3. Ordinance (ID # 25-1686) Referred for Recommendation: By Councilor Wilson Amending Chapter 8, Article III of the Code of Ordinances pertaining to secondhand dealer licenses. Page 1 of 2
Legislative Matters Committee Regular Meeting Agenda December 2, 2025 4. Ordinance (ID # 25-0357) Referred for Recommendation: By Councilor Clingan Amending Section 12-8 (a) of the Code of Ordinances by inserting the words “including abutting curb cuts if applicable”. 5. Mayor's Request (ID # 25-1652) Referred for Recommendation: Requesting ordainment of an amendment to Section 2-309.9 and 2-309.10 of the Code of Ordinances to clarify term length and appointment process for the Community Preservation Committee. 6. Mayor's Request (ID # 25-1714) Referred for Recommendation: Requesting ordainment of an amendment to Section 12-178 of the Code of Ordinances to remove the prohibition on sourcing neonicotinoid-treated plants. 7. Officer's Communication (ID # 25-1676) Referred for Recommendation: City Clerk submitting an amendment to the Rules of the City Council to align with the provisions of the City Charter. Surveillance Technology Impact Reports 8. Mayor's Request (ID # 25-1605) Referred for Recommendation: Requesting approval of the Surveillance Technology Impact Report for Ball Cameras. 9. Mayor's Request (ID # 25-1604) Referred for Recommendation: Requesting approval of the Surveillance Technology Impact Report for Thermal Imaging Monoculars. 10. Mayor's Request (ID # 25-1603) Referred for Recommendation: Requesting approval of the Surveillance Technology Impact Report for Under Door Cameras. 11. Mayor's Request (ID # 25-1579) Referred for Recommendation: Requesting approval of the Surveillance Technology Impact Report for use of an Unmanned Aircraft System at the High School. Page 2 of 2
